From mboxrd@z Thu Jan 1 00:00:00 1970 From: =?UTF-8?q?Alex=20Benn=C3=A9e?= Subject: [PATCH v2 02/10] KVM: define common __KVM_GUESTDBG_USE_SW/HW_BP values Date: Tue, 31 Mar 2015 16:08:00 +0100 Message-ID: <1427814488-28467-3-git-send-email-alex.bennee@linaro.org> References: <1427814488-28467-1-git-send-email-alex.bennee@linaro.org> Mime-Version: 1.0 Content-Type: text/plain; charset="utf-8" Content-Transfer-Encoding: base64 Return-path: In-Reply-To: <1427814488-28467-1-git-send-email-alex.bennee@linaro.org> List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Errors-To: kvmarm-bounces@lists.cs.columbia.edu Sender: kvmarm-bounces@lists.cs.columbia.edu To: kvm@vger.kernel.org, linux-arm-kernel@lists.infradead.org, kvmarm@lists.cs.columbia.edu, christoffer.dall@linaro.org, marc.zyngier@arm.com, peter.maydell@linaro.org, agraf@suse.de, drjones@redhat.com, pbonzini@redhat.com, zhichao.huang@linaro.org Cc: "maintainer:X86 ARCHITECTURE..." , Benjamin Herrenschmidt , Alexey Kardashevskiy , Nadav Amit , Gleb Natapov , jan.kiszka@siemens.com, "H. Peter Anvin" , "open list:LINUX FOR POWERPC..." , "open list:ABI/API" , open list , dahi@linux.vnet.ibm.com, Ingo Molnar , Paul Mackerras , Michael Ellerman , r65777@freescale.com, Thomas Gleixner , bp@suse.de List-Id: linux-api@vger.kernel.org Q3VycmVudGx5IHg4NiwgcG93ZXJwYyBhbmQgc29vbiBhcm02NCB1c2UgdGhlIHNhbWUgdHdvIGFy Y2hpdGVjdHVyZQpzcGVjaWZpYyBiaXRzIGZvciBndWVzdCBkZWJ1ZyBzdXBwb3J0IGZvciBzb2Z0 d2FyZSBhbmQgaGFyZHdhcmUKYnJlYWtwb2ludHMuIFRoaXMgbWFrZXMgdGhlIHNoYXJlZCB2YWx1 ZXMgZXhwbGljaXQgd2hpbGUgbGVhdmluZyB0aGUKZ2F0ZSBvcGVuIGZvciBhbm90aGVyIGFyY2hp dGVjdHVyZSB0byB1c2Ugc29tZSBvdGhlciB2YWx1ZSBpZiB0aGV5CnJlYWxseSByZWFsbHkgd2Fu dCB0by4KClNpZ25lZC1vZmYtYnk6IEFsZXggQmVubsOpZSA8YWxleC5iZW5uZWVAbGluYXJvLm9y Zz4KCmRpZmYgLS1naXQgYS9hcmNoL3Bvd2VycGMvaW5jbHVkZS91YXBpL2FzbS9rdm0uaCBiL2Fy Y2gvcG93ZXJwYy9pbmNsdWRlL3VhcGkvYXNtL2t2bS5oCmluZGV4IGFiNGQ0NzMuLjE3MzE1Njkg MTAwNjQ0Ci0tLSBhL2FyY2gvcG93ZXJwYy9pbmNsdWRlL3VhcGkvYXNtL2t2bS5oCisrKyBiL2Fy Y2gvcG93ZXJwYy9pbmNsdWRlL3VhcGkvYXNtL2t2bS5oCkBAIC0zMTAsOCArMzEwLDggQEAgc3Ry dWN0IGt2bV9ndWVzdF9kZWJ1Z19hcmNoIHsKICAqIGFuZCB1cHBlciAxNiBiaXRzIGFyZSBhcmNo aXRlY3R1cmUgc3BlY2lmaWMuIEFyY2hpdGVjdHVyZSBzcGVjaWZpYyBkZWZpbmVzCiAgKiB0aGF0 IGlvY3RsIGlzIGZvciBzZXR0aW5nIGhhcmR3YXJlIGJyZWFrcG9pbnQgb3Igc29mdHdhcmUgYnJl YWtwb2ludC4KICAqLwotI2RlZmluZSBLVk1fR1VFU1REQkdfVVNFX1NXX0JQCQkweDAwMDEwMDAw Ci0jZGVmaW5lIEtWTV9HVUVTVERCR19VU0VfSFdfQlAJCTB4MDAwMjAwMDAKKyNkZWZpbmUgS1ZN X0dVRVNUREJHX1VTRV9TV19CUAkJX19LVk1fR1VFU1REQkdfVVNFX1NXX0JQCisjZGVmaW5lIEtW TV9HVUVTVERCR19VU0VfSFdfQlAJCV9fS1ZNX0dVRVNUREJHX1VTRV9IV19CUAogCiAvKiBkZWZp bml0aW9uIG9mIHJlZ2lzdGVycyBpbiBrdm1fcnVuICovCiBzdHJ1Y3Qga3ZtX3N5bmNfcmVncyB7 CmRpZmYgLS1naXQgYS9hcmNoL3g4Ni9pbmNsdWRlL3VhcGkvYXNtL2t2bS5oIGIvYXJjaC94ODYv aW5jbHVkZS91YXBpL2FzbS9rdm0uaAppbmRleCBkN2RjZWY1Li4xNDM4MjAyIDEwMDY0NAotLS0g YS9hcmNoL3g4Ni9pbmNsdWRlL3VhcGkvYXNtL2t2bS5oCisrKyBiL2FyY2gveDg2L2luY2x1ZGUv dWFwaS9hc20va3ZtLmgKQEAgLTI1MCw4ICsyNTAsOCBAQCBzdHJ1Y3Qga3ZtX2RlYnVnX2V4aXRf YXJjaCB7CiAJX191NjQgZHI3OwogfTsKIAotI2RlZmluZSBLVk1fR1VFU1REQkdfVVNFX1NXX0JQ CQkweDAwMDEwMDAwCi0jZGVmaW5lIEtWTV9HVUVTVERCR19VU0VfSFdfQlAJCTB4MDAwMjAwMDAK KyNkZWZpbmUgS1ZNX0dVRVNUREJHX1VTRV9TV19CUAkJX19LVk1fR1VFU1REQkdfVVNFX1NXX0JQ CisjZGVmaW5lIEtWTV9HVUVTVERCR19VU0VfSFdfQlAJCV9fS1ZNX0dVRVNUREJHX1VTRV9IV19C UAogI2RlZmluZSBLVk1fR1VFU1REQkdfSU5KRUNUX0RCCQkweDAwMDQwMDAwCiAjZGVmaW5lIEtW TV9HVUVTVERCR19JTkpFQ1RfQlAJCTB4MDAwODAwMDAKIApkaWZmIC0tZ2l0IGEvaW5jbHVkZS91 YXBpL2xpbnV4L2t2bS5oIGIvaW5jbHVkZS91YXBpL2xpbnV4L2t2bS5oCmluZGV4IDVlZWRmODQu LmNlMmRiMTQgMTAwNjQ0Ci0tLSBhL2luY2x1ZGUvdWFwaS9saW51eC9rdm0uaAorKysgYi9pbmNs dWRlL3VhcGkvbGludXgva3ZtLmgKQEAgLTUyNSw4ICs1MjUsMTYgQEAgc3RydWN0IGt2bV9zMzkw X2lycSB7CiAKIC8qIGZvciBLVk1fU0VUX0dVRVNUX0RFQlVHICovCiAKLSNkZWZpbmUgS1ZNX0dV RVNUREJHX0VOQUJMRQkJMHgwMDAwMDAwMQotI2RlZmluZSBLVk1fR1VFU1REQkdfU0lOR0xFU1RF UAkJMHgwMDAwMDAwMgorI2RlZmluZSBLVk1fR1VFU1REQkdfRU5BQkxFCQkoMSA8PCAwKQorI2Rl ZmluZSBLVk1fR1VFU1REQkdfU0lOR0xFU1RFUAkoMSA8PCAxKQorCisvKgorICogQXJjaGl0ZWN0 dXJlIHNwZWNpZmljIHN0dWZmIHVzZXMgdGhlIHRvcCAxNiBiaXRzIG9mIHRoZSBmaWVsZCwKKyAq IGhvd2V2ZXIgdGhlcmUgaXMgc29tZSBzaGFyZWQgY29tbW9uYWxpdHkgZm9yIHRoZSBjb21tb24g Y2FzZXMKKyAqLworI2RlZmluZSBfX0tWTV9HVUVTVERCR19VU0VfU1dfQlAJKDEgPDwgMTYpCisj ZGVmaW5lIF9fS1ZNX0dVRVNUREJHX1VTRV9IV19CUAkoMSA8PCAxNykKKwogCiBzdHJ1Y3Qga3Zt X2d1ZXN0X2RlYnVnIHsKIAlfX3UzMiBjb250cm9sOwotLSAKMi4zLjQKCl9fX19fX19fX19fX19f X19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fCmt2bWFybSBtYWlsaW5nIGxpc3QKa3Zt YXJtQGxpc3RzLmNzLmNvbHVtYmlhLmVkdQpodHRwczovL2xpc3RzLmNzLmNvbHVtYmlhLmVkdS9t YWlsbWFuL2xpc3RpbmZvL2t2bWFybQo=